Subfloor Replacement in Kansas City, KS
Subfloor replacement services involve removing and replacing the underlying layer of flooring material that sits directly on the floor joists. This service is often needed in projects such as remodeling, water damage repairs, or addressing structural issues caused by rot, mold, or prolonged wear. Property owners typically seek subfloor replacement when the existing subfloor has become compromised, warped, or weakened, which can lead to uneven flooring, squeaks, or further damage to finished surfaces above.
Before requesting subfloor replacement, homeowners should understand the extent of the damage and whether the issue is isolated or widespread across the area. It’s important to consider the type of subfloor material currently installed, the scope of the project, and any underlying problems that may have contributed to the deterioration. Proper assessment ensures that the replacement process restores the floor’s stability and supports the finished flooring effectively.

Subfloor Replacement Questions
What signs indicate a subfloor needs replacement? Signs include sagging floors, uneven surfaces, or visible damage beneath the surface material.
Can subfloor replacement be done in existing homes? Yes, it is possible to replace the subfloor in most existing properties with proper access.
What types of subfloor materials are commonly used? Plywood and oriented strand board (OSB) are common choices for subfloor replacement projects.
Is subfloor replacement necessary for remodeling projects? If the current subfloor is damaged or compromised, replacement helps ensure a stable foundation for finishes.
